European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en has requested more details from EU Trade Commissioner Phil Hogan after the Golfgate controversy. For more we were joined by Luke “Ming” Flanagan, MEP for Midlands North West.

Supreme Court Judge Séamus Woulfe is also in hot water for his attendance at the now infamous  Oireachtas golf dinner. Former Minister for Transport, Shane Ross gave us his reaction.
